PANO - 29 dragon dancing teams from 29 districts in Hanoi, on October 6th, took part in the third Dragon Dancing Festival 2012, as organized by the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ism of Hanoi, at the My Dinh National Stadium.
The event is part of activities to mark the 58th anniversary of Capital Liberation Day (October 10, 1954).
The Dragon Dancing Festival is an annual event to promote the nation’s cultural values and raise the pride of Hanoians.
